Automatic and voluntary orienting of attention in visual search: two independent processes?

CASAGRANDE, Maria;MARTELLA, DIANA;MAROTTA, ANDREA
2008

Abstract

Eighteen subjects performed two visual searchtasks, characterized by different cognitive load,which required to identify a vertical segmentbetween other segments, all with the same orientation,and a distractor that could be presented ornot. By varying the orientation of both targets anddistractors, it was manipulated the salience and thesimilarity between them, deemed considerable forbottom-up and top-down components respectively.Results showed a salience by similarity interaction,suggesting that, while in high cognitive loadconditions endogenous and exogenous components can act independently, when the task requires mildattentional resources, the two processes give rise toan interaction.
